Post by Ian Nicholls on Mon Apr 20, 2009 6:16 pm

The latest is that I have contacted the insurance company, first at midday when they promised to phone me back, which they didn't and then I phoned them at 5-30pm.
I am insured with Kinetic via HIC.
Kinetic want to use a salvage company to take my car away and then deal with me. I told them I wanted to keep the car and they send an engineer to inspect it. Tim assures me I have the right to insist on this.
Having narrowly avoided an appointment with the grim reaper I am determined to see H829FLE back on the road with the insurance companies help or not.

You have the right to salvage retention with HIC.

You must use the term salvage retention in the event of a write off.

You have right to retain YOUR vehicle and refuse collection from a salvage company.. Its YOUR car to do with as YOU wish. No insurance company can force collection upon you.
